| After the Anti-Japanese war, The KMT and the Communist Party had a fierce military competition in Subei, the war continued, coupled with frequent natural disasters in Subei, Subei people can not survive in the local and had to flee to Shanghai. To settle these refugees is the National Government's duties, In this paper, the research's object is Subei refugee in Shanghai, this paper analysis the general situation of the refugees, described the national government's and the civil society's relief measures for refugee, finally discusses the national government's relief refugee effectiveness and shortcomings.This Paper is divided into five parts:The first part describes the basic conditions of Shanghai Subei refugees, because the war and famine produced a large number of refugees, refugees lack the ability to help themselves and need help immediately; The second part make a description of the national government setting up refugee's relief agencies, policies and non-governmental's relief agencies; The third part describes the refugee relief measures by national government and private sector. National government helped refugees by official relief agencies, and non-governmental Association collected relief funds and carried out registration for refugees, through the issuance of supplies, small loans for refugees, organizing emergency relief, repatriation of refugees to return home and a series of measures to enable a large number of refugees had been resettled. In the relief process, those organizations in Northern Association in Shanghai, "Shanghai interim relief of refugees in exile in Northern Committee" played a huge role in society.The fourth part discussed the national government's effectiveness and inadequate of refugees relief. Although the National government's refugee relief system and work were becoming increasingly standardized and institutionalized, China was experiencing in a long war and civil war, with the serious inflation, and some supplies were scarce, along with the KMT's own corruption, the Nationalist government's relief effect was not very satisfactory, weakened the role as a Government. The Part V analyses the civil relief of refugees and its leading role in relief. |
